AM General is Hiring a Field Service Representative - Test Site Support Near Yuma, AZ

INTRODUCTION TO AM GENERAL
AM General develops and builds specialized ground vehicle systems that get the US Armed Services and our allies to and from their mission safely. Our innovative spirit delivers advanced, rugged, resilient, and dependable mobility solutions. We are one team dedicated to producing the best products for our customers. We have a collective understanding that at AM General our purpose is to serve those who serve to protect us.

PRINCIPLE D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ES
  • Serve as Subject Matter Expert on all AM General automotive systems including the JLTV (Joint Light Tactical Vehicle), trailers, and HMMWV (High Mobility Multi Wheeled Vehicle) including having excellent technical knowledge, tooling requirements, and maintenance procedures to support customers worldwide
  • Attend vehicle training on the new JLTV A2 FoV & trailers in South Bend, Indiana and/or also Michigan
  • Support contract requirements by conducting short- and long-term field service support to customers worldwide
  • Support customers with technical and service inquiries and deliver the highest level of customer support
  • Support our Engineering group during testing efforts at various test sites throughout CONUS & OCONUS as necessary
  • Support the AM General Military Training department by providing OPNET & FLMNET training to both U.S. and Foreign customers
  • Provide highly detailed field service reports outlining program status, vehicle status, deficiencies, and all repairs
  • Perform troubleshooting and Maintenance in support of prototype Government vehicle testing and all other AM General departmental operations as required
  • Promotes AM General Training and Field Service department capabilities to customers worldwide
  • Serve as liaison between customer field operations and manufacturing, engineering, and quality for component issues and or other product concerns
  • Provide daily vehicle status updates in written and verbal format
  • Support both the opening and closing of the Test Facility/Testing Event
  • Participating in Test Meetings, Test Readiness Review (TRR), and FACAR (Failure Analysis and Corrective Action Report) Reviews via teleconference or on-site
  • Review released Test Incident Reports (TIRs) through the Vision Digital Library System (VDLS) and deliver FACAR responses as required
  • Performs all task orders assigned by the Manager of Test Site Operations
  • Be willing to travel to stand up and support other Government Test Site locations besides the main place of work as required
KNOWLEDGE AND SKILLS
  • An automotive vocational degree or five-year automotive technical experience is a must
  • Automotive Service and Excellence (ASE) Certifications are a plus
  • Prior Military Occupational Specialty (MOS) experience in the maintenance field related to the JLTV (Joint Light Tactical Vehicle) its companion trailers, and the HMMWV (High Mobility Multi Wheeled Vehicle) FoV is desirable
  • Previous experience in both Operator and Maintainer level instruction is highly beneficial in this role
  • Highly proficient with Microsoft Suite (Word, Excel, PowerPoint, and SharePoint) is required
  • Willingness to travel within CONUS and OCONUS locations for extended periods and have sufficient credit to be approved for a company credit card
  • Able to identify, troubleshoot, and permanently correct automotive electrical, pneumatic, hydraulic, and mechanical issues and apply a wide range of mechanical concepts and principles in order to rapidly return test assets to mission-capable status
  • Must have extremely strong communication skills in English (written and verbal), the ability to work independently and as part of a team, multi-task with attention to detail, have strong customer service skills with problem-solving skills, and a high level of initiative
  • Extensive working knowledge of diagnostic and repair equipment
  • Have a solid understanding of the theory and operation of a CAN BUS network and be able to troubleshoot/repair is a plus
  • Experience providing both Government and OEM prototype test site support, Total Package Fielding (TPF) as it pertains to the JLTV is desirable
  • High level of integrity and professionalism
  • Ability to secure a US Government Security Clearance

TRAVEL REQUIREMENTS
Up to 90% travel may be required. Must have or be able to obtain a US Passport.
